According to TIOBE's index of most popular programming languages, C# and VB.NET are some of the most popular languages used. C# is the5th most popular this year and VB.NET is the13th. In my opinion, there is very little point in learning both C# and VB.NET as they both utilize the .NET framework. Choose the language you are most comfortable with and stick with that.

 

TIOBE Index for October2014

 

However, it all depends on what kind of developer you'd like to be. Here are some of the popular languages in each category:

 

Web development:

ASP.NET with C# or VB.NET

PHP

Ruby on Rails

 

Computer:

C

Java

C++

C# or VB.NET (Windows exclusive)

Objective-C (Mac exclusive)

 

Mobile:

Objective-C (iOS)

Java (Android, Blackberry)

C# or VB.NET (Windows Phone)

Mono for C# (iOS, Android)
